Napoleon-- I don't believe prisoners stay full-time in the prison. It is just treated the same way apartments or houses are treated by regular folks. Yeah, it is strange.
Goddess-- You have to use the arrest edict and click on people to put them in prison. Your city's cops come arrest them, and their new home is the slammer, either making license plates or being reeducated (having their respect increased).

To expand on the point made, Yes -- you can issue the Edict with a Jail on the map. BUT the Jail has to have at least one employee before the Policemen will actually 'arrest' the unit. When the assigned Policeman contacts the unit to be 'arrested', the "overhead" goes away and the two of them have to travel to the Jail. When the arrested unit actually enters the building, the Policeman is released and typically goes home to sleep.
